5/27/2023 0 Comments Monolingual spanishMore importantly, such difficulty is further compounded when one considers that there are unique manifestations of cognitive impairments in Spanish speaking individuals. Collectively, neuropsychological test performances of Spanish speakers can be difficult to interpret due to these aforementioned limitations. Moreover, even when a neuropsychologist has the ability to provide services to Spanish speakers, there is a lack of instruments and/or normative data available to make proper diagnoses and treatment recommendations ( Puente & Ardila, 2000). Notably, this study found that a significant number of neuropsychologists in the United States report that their professional work involves providing services to ethnic minority individuals however, these neuropsychologists report having little or no training in working specifically with the Hispanic population ( Echemendia, Harris, Congett, Diaz, & Puente, 1997). While the need for Spanish speaking health care services is clear, only one comprehensive study has examined the extent of culturally competent neuropsychological services available for Hispanics. Considering the language barriers and cultural differences present in this growing population, the delivery of neuropsychological services needs to be culturally and linguistically appropriate. Within this minority group, approximately 76% are Spanish speakers at home, with approximately 47% requiring assistance with the English language. Census reports that the Hispanic population has increased by 43% from 2000 to 2010, making it the largest minority group in the United States ( U.S. The delivery of culturally and linguistically appropriate neuropsychological services, particularly for the growing population of Spanish speaking patients, is among the biggest challenges currently facing clinical neuropsychology.
